Instructions for Windows Vista

  1. Click Start and then Control Panel
  2. In Control Panel, if you are in Classic View, click on Control Panel Home (top left corner)
  3. Open Clock, Language, and Region
  4. Click on Regional and Language Options.
  5. Click the Keyboards and Languages tab and then click Change keyboards.
  6. Under Installed services, click Add.
  7. In the Add Input Language dialog box, select the keyboard layout you would like to add from the list available and click OK.
  8. The keyboard layout you added will be included in the list. To set the new layout as your default, select it from the list. Click OK to save your changes
  9. You can switch between different input languages (= keyboard languages) by clicking on the Language Bar button or by pressing the Alt + Shift keys

Instructions for Windows XP
  1. Click Start and then Control Panel
  2. In Control Panel, if you are in Category View, click on Switch to Classic View (top left corner)
  3. Open Regional and Language Options.
  4. Click on the Languages tab.
  5. Under Text services and input languages, click on the Details button.
  6. Under Installed services, click Add.
  7. In the Add Input Language dialog box, choose the input language and keyboard layout or Input Method Editor (IME) you want to add.
  8. Click OK twice. You should now see a language indicator in the System Tray (located at bottom right hand corner of the desktop by default). You can switch between different input languages (= keyboard languages) by pressing the Alt + Shift keys


If a language does not appear in the Input language list, the fonts for that language might not be installed. If that is the case, follow the instructions below.

Add language support
  1. Click Start and then Control Panel
  2. In Control Panel, if you are in Category View, click on Switch to Classic View
  3. Open Regional and Language Options in Control Panel.
  4. Click on the Languages tab.
  5. Under Supplemental language support, select the check box beside the applicable language collection
  6. Click OK or Apply. You will prompted to insert the Windows CD-ROM or point to a network location where the files are located. After the files are installed, you must restart your computer.

My comment section of facebook is listed in a foreign language

Facebook is available in 70 languages.
The language settings can be easily changeda few clicks and your whole page will be displayed in the selected language.

This can make changing it back difficult at first glance.
If you've inadvertently switched languages, going back to English is easy if you know where to look.

Log in to your account and follow a few simple steps that work regardless of the language you've changed to.

Visit facebook.com on your PC language settings are not available on the mobile site.
Enter your email address and password into the fields at the top of the page, then click the "Log In" button.

Scroll to the very bottom of the page.
You will see the word "Facebook" followed by a copyright logo.
Your current language is displayed next to the copyright symbol.

Click on the language a popup window appears, displaying all the available languages.

Click "English," then select your desired version of English.

NO English on my TI 84

Hello,
English is the default language. If someone changed the setting, it must be because he/she used a foreign language locale. Press Apps and look for a foreign language Français, Espagnol, Svenka, Deutch and so on. Execute the one locale that you know a litle bit of. When the application executes it will ask you 1: English, 2: the other language. Press 1:English and you will be back in chartered territory.
If you do not need the other languages, delete those applications: You will have more memory to put some other applications that interest you more.
